## Changelog — Queuewright migration

Replaced the homegrown Dispatchly job queue with Queuewright across all worker pools. Retry semantics changed: exponential backoff is now default, max attempts dropped from 10 to 5. Dead-letter handling moved to a dedicated topic; the old failure table is read-only. Cron-style jobs were ported without schedule changes. Verify your consumers tolerate at-least-once delivery. The new defaults are as follows.

settings of tagef-bawif:
DRUIX_HOST=druix.zemvarlabs.internal
DRUIX_PORT=8000

## Runbook: Gaugepile Sidecar — Release Checklist

Heads up: the sidecar ships with every app pod, so a bad config fans out fast. Before cutting a release, confirm the flush interval hasn't drifted from what the Tallyhouse aggregator expects, or you'll see sawtooth gaps in dashboards. Rollbacks are cheap — just repin the image tag. Canary one node pool first, watch for ten minutes, then proceed. The values to verify against are these.

config for bagep-yafof:
quenath:
  pin: 8584
  metrics_host: metrics.quenath.tolvaqsys.internal
  tenant: pelath
  seal: seal_ed102645

## Formula sandbox tuning

User-supplied formulas in Gridmoor execute inside a restricted interpreter with hard ceilings on time, memory, and call depth. Reviewers should confirm any change to these ceilings is justified in the PR description, since raising them widens the abuse surface. Defaults were chosen from production traces. The current limits are as follows.

limits module of tafog-fawip:
WEIGHTS = {
    "julix": 57,
    "lamys": 992,
    "kasvan": 209,
    "quenok": 750,
    "alddor": 259,
    "oliath": 1009,
    "wenix": 815,
}

Cron drift on the Lanternfall scheduler resurfaced after the v4.2 deploy. We confirmed the drift accumulates roughly 40ms per run because the tick handler awaits a synchronous flush before rescheduling. The fix reschedules against the original anchor timestamp, not completion time. Please review the anchor arithmetic carefully for leap-second edge cases. The full investigation timeline is documented on the internal page below.

dashboard of tawef-hagug = https://superset.norvadyn.local/display/projects/build/ticket/build/spaces/ticket/1e989f0e6c200d20fc4ae06b